The legislative process can often be seen as inefficient due to its complexity, lengthy timelines, and the need for extensive debate and compromise among diverse political interests. These factors can lead to gridlock, where important legislation is stalled or fails to pass. However, this complexity also serves a purpose, allowing for thorough examination and input from various stakeholders, which can enhance the quality of the laws enacted. Ultimately, while inefficiencies exist, they can also protect democratic principles and ensure comprehensive governance.

What components of the dynamic legislative process is mostly left out of the textbook legislative process?

The influence of lobbying and special interest groups, political party dynamics, and behind-the-scenes negotiations are often left out of the textbook legislative process. These components can greatly impact the outcome of legislation but are not always openly discussed in traditional educational materials.
